タグ

JavaScriptと*programに関するhatano99のブックマーク (2)

  • Web Messaging API を使ってみる - Qiita

    目的 HTML5 に Web Messaging API というのがある。サーバを介さずブラウザ間で通信ができるインターフェイスが提供されている。 調査がてら把握したことを整理。 概要と用途 Web Messaging API はブラウザの任意のドキュメント間での通信をサポートするインターフェイス。現在、postMessage と MessageChannel という API が用意されている。どちらも任意の window オブジェクト同士で、任意のタイミングでデータの受送信をさせることが可能。 よく使われる用途として、iframe で別ドメインのコンテンツを読み込み、そのドメインと通信させる。 例えば、Facebook のいいねボタンは、 iframe で facebook.com のドメインを埋め込み通信させ、その中の cookie の値を取得してそのブラウザが保持するユーザ情報を表示

    Web Messaging API を使ってみる - Qiita
  • Node.jsの開発時に必要な情報(2020年9月更新) - Qiita

    注意 この記事は、2014年の段階でNode.jsの開発時にデバッグ~継続的インテグレーションが行えるようにするために必要な情報をまとめていました。 その後、2020年08月にnode v12.18.3を対象に調査しなおしました。 Node.jsのインストール方法 ここから、インストーラなりソースなり取得してインストールする。 Windows,Macはインストーラが存在している。 Windowsの場合、VS2008や、VS2012などの複数のVisualStudioが混在している環境だとnpm installが失敗することがあった。 その場合は、環境変数を調整してVisualStudioのバージョンを指定して動作するようにしておくこと。 Node.jsのデバッグ方法(2020年) ローカルのデバッグ Visual Studio Codeでアプリケーションのあるフォルダを開いて実行すると、デ

    Node.jsの開発時に必要な情報(2020年9月更新) - Qiita
  • 1